#1163eb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1163eb is composed of 6.7% red, 38.8%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.8% cyan, 57.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 217.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 49.4%. #1163eb color hex could be obtained by blending #22c6ff with #0000d7.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#1163eb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1163eb has RGB values of R:17, G:99,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 1139691.

Shades and Tints of #1163eb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01070f is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.
